Thirty-Eighth Annual Exhibition of the Society of Scottish Artists, 1931
Start Date: 28 November 1931
End Date: 9 January 1932
Type: Annual exhibition
Description: A wide variety of mediums were displayed alongside sculptures. Examples include painting, prints and cases of craftwork objects.
Policy: All works an sale, where a commission of ten per cent goes to Society regardless of sale being initiated by artist.
A deposit of one fourth of the exhibition price must be paid before a work is marked 'sold'.
No work purchased can be removed until after the close of the exhibition and then only when the price has been paid to the custodian. Works not removed within three days after the close of the Exhibition will be dealt with by the agent of the Society at the owner's risk and expense.
Price of Admission - 1s.
Season Tickets - 5s.
Children - half price.
